Abstract
The invention discloses a kind of small primer of resistance to oiled boots of fitting method, calculate in parts by weight, including butadiene-styrene rubber 90, nitrile rubber 10, neoprene 1.5, sulphur 0.4 0.5, captax 0.1 0.2, zinc oxide 5, magnesia 4, stearic acid 1.5, antioxidant D 1.5 2.5, calcium carbonate 20 40, pine tar 5, dibutyl ester 15, dark substitute 5, carbon black 20, semi-reinforcing hydrocarbon black 10.Rubber and fluid medium solubility parameter great disparity, have preferable oil resistivity;Softening agent is based on dibutyl ester, and with part pine tar, dark substitute;Filler calcium carbonate dosage suitably increases, and contributes to anti-swelling;State of cure (vulcanization) improves, and crosslink density is high, and oil-resistant effect is preferable.With the small primer of formula production, its oil resistance is preferable, and cost is relatively low, adapts to contact the operating environment of oils, suitable for the protection of oil operations.
Description
Technical field
The present invention relates to rubber overshoes manufacturing field, is related to the small primer formula of boots, more particularly to a kind of resistance to oiled boots of fitting method are used
Small primer.
Background technology
Handle, refers to the big bottom less than 38 yards, shoes made of General Purpose Rubber material, and its small primer is usually that natural rubber adds
Upper synthetic rubber, use range is wide, cost is low, but because natural rubber and fluid medium solubility parameter are not greatly different enough, causes
Small primer oil resistivity is poor, and therefore, conventional small primer formula can not be used for the protection boots for contacting oils.
The content of the invention
The purpose of the present invention is in view of the shortcomings of the prior art, and to provide a kind of resistance to oiled boots of fitting method small primer, with this
Its oil resistance of the small primer of formula production is preferable, and cost is relatively low, adapts to the operating environment of oil resistant, suitable for oil resistant operation
Protection.
Realizing the technical scheme of the object of the invention is:
A kind of small primer of resistance to oiled boots of fitting method, is calculated in parts by weight, including
Butadiene-styrene rubber 90, nitrile rubber 10, neoprene 1.5, sulphur 0.4-0.5, captax 0.1-0.2, zinc oxide 5, oxygen
Change magnesium 4, stearic acid 1.5, antioxidant D 1.5-2.5, calcium carbonate 20-40, pine tar 5, dibutyl ester 15, dark substitute 5, carbon black 20,
Semi-reinforcing hydrocarbon black 10.
The advantage of the invention is that:It is combined using butadiene-styrene rubber and butyronitrile, neoprene, rubber and fluid medium solubility
Parameter great disparity, has preferable oil resistivity;Softening agent is based on dibutyl ester, and with part pine tar, dark substitute;Filler carbonic acid
Calcium dosage suitably increases, and contributes to anti-swelling;State of cure (vulcanization) improves, and crosslink density is high, and oil-resistant effect is preferable.Produced with the formula
Small primer its oil resistance it is preferable, cost is relatively low, adapts to contact the operating environment of oils, suitable for the anti-of oil operations
Shield.
Embodiment
Present invention is further elaborated below by embodiment, but is not limitation of the invention.
A kind of small primer of resistance to oiled boots of fitting method, is calculated in parts by weight, including
Butadiene-styrene rubber 90, nitrile rubber 10, neoprene 1.5, sulphur 0.4-0.5, captax 0.1-0.2, zinc oxide 5, oxygen
Change magnesium 4, stearic acid 1.5, antioxidant D 1.5-2.5, calcium carbonate 20-40, pine tar 5, dibutyl ester 15, dark substitute 5, carbon black 20,
Semi-reinforcing hydrocarbon black 10.
Embodiment:
A kind of small primer of resistance to oiled boots of fitting method, is calculated in parts by weight, including
Butadiene-styrene rubber 90, nitrile rubber 10, neoprene 1.5, sulphur 0.45, captax 0.15, zinc oxide 5, magnesia 4,
Stearic acid 1.5, antioxidant D 1.9, calcium carbonate 30, pine tar 5, dibutyl ester 15, dark substitute 5, carbon black 20, semi-reinforcing hydrocarbon black 10.
Preparation method:
The rubber of formula ratio is added in banbury and is kneaded completely, stearic acid, carbon black, accelerator is then added and is mixed in mill
Refining is complete, and the age resistor, plasticizer, filler for adding formula ratio continue to be kneaded completely, and it is complete to be eventually adding sulphur mixing.
